Air fryer shrimp

Preparation Time: 10 minutes

Cooking Time: 8 minutes

Servings: 2-4

Difficulty Level: Easy

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• Chopped fresh parsley for garnish
  • Lemon wedges for serving

Instructions:

  1. Preheat Air Fryer:
    • Pre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Prepare the Shrimp:
    • In a bowl, toss the shrimp with olive oil, minced garlic, lemon zest, lemon juice, paprika, dried oregano, salt, and black pepper. Ensure the shrimp are well-coated.
  3. Arrange in the Air Fryer Basket:
    • Place the marinated shrimp in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Avoid overcrowding to ensure even cooking.
  4. Air Fry:
    • Cook the shrimp in the preheated air fryer for 8 minutes, shaking the basket halfway through to ensure even cooking.
  5. Check for Doneness:
    • The shrimp are done when they are opaque and cooked through.
  6. Garnish:
    • Sprinkle chopped fresh parsley over the cooked shrimp for added freshness and color.
  7. Serve:
    • Transfer the air-fried shrimp to a serving plate and serve with lemon wedges on the side.
  8. Enjoy Your Air Fryer Shrimp!
    • Enjoy these flavorful and juicy air-fried shrimp as a quick and delicious appetizer or main dish.

Note:

  • You can customize the seasoning according to your taste preferences. Add a pinch of cayenne pepper for a spicy kick.
  • Serve the shrimp over a bed of rice, pasta, or a fresh salad for a complete meal.
  • Adjust the cooking time based on the size of the shrimp. Larger shrimp may require a couple of extra minutes.
